Two Andalites - centaur-like alien creatures with blue fur, four eyes (two on eye stalks), and blades on the tip of their long, scorpion-like tails - lay on their stomachs in the grass by a sparkling blue brook. They each stick a deer-like hoof in the water. The smaller, more periwinkle Andalite is in profile, looking out into the distance. The larger, darker blue Andalite is holding a book, and all four of his eyes are looking at the other Andalite. They blush slightly.

On this day—59 years ago—#StarTrek premiered on American television with the episode “The Man Trap” and history was made. The episode was chosen to be first because it had action, a monster, and showed “strange new worlds.” Happy #StarTrekDay!
